【推荐1】In an effort to slow the spread of the coronavirus, many New York City venues are closed. Here’s a selection of art to be found around town.

Jane Freilicher

For more than fifty years, as Abstract Expressionism gave way to Pop, then to Minimalism, and on to Neo-Expressionism, until art’s isms (主义) exhausted themselves, Freilicher devoted herself to painting “eternally fixed afternoons”, finding beauty at home. The fifteen works in the exhibition at the Kasmin gallery, lead you into the artist’s inside.—Andrea K. Scott (kasmingallery.com)

Betye Saar

Two years ago, the Getty Research Institute mentioned Betye Saar as “the conscience (良心) of the art world for over fifty years”. The small but abundant exhibition “Betye Saar: Call and Response”, at the Morgan Library & Museum, pairs the artist’s found-object collection with her less often seen sketchbooks (素描簿).—A.K.S. (themorgan.org)

Frederick Weston

When this black, H. I. V.—positive artist arrived in New York from Detroit, in 1973, he wanted to become a fashion designer. But the city’s culture scene at the time was overwhelmingly white, and Weston withdrew into a world that he could control. An exhibition of Weston’s work is on view at Ortuzar Projects, which is to remind us that society’s best visual critics often fall through the cracks, and to question why it still takes us so long to recognize them.—Hilton Als (ortuzarprojects.com)

Stella Zhong

A raised floor, the color of greenish grey transforms the Chapter gallery into something like a sci-fi stage set or a mini golf course. Zhong, who was born in Shenzhen, China, achieves an effect that is playful and strangely cold. Moving around in the exhibition is rather like living in the space of a video game.—J. F. (chapter-ny.com)

【推荐2】The best destinations for 2022

As much of the world is slowly reopening following the coronavirus pandemic (疫情), travel is front of mind for so many of us. The hope is that 2022 will see families reunited and vacation time used on once-in-a-lifetime experiences. We list several places you should have on your bucket list.


Egypt

Egypt is home to the Pyramids of Giza, one of the seven wonders of the world. But don’t think that “old” means “dull”. Despite their 4,500+ years of history, we are still learning more about these architectural marvels every year.


Nepal

It’s nearly impossible to discuss Nepal without talking about Mount Everest. But this Himalayan nation has so much more on offer for travelers who aren’t climbing the world’s highest mountain. In the remote region, travelers can explore the high desert and meet locals at home-slays along the way, dining on Nepali specialties like coffee and momos served “kothey” style-half fried and half steamed.


Slovenia

Thanks to the country’s small size, visitors can cover a wide range of places in a short amount of time, from breathtaking Lake Bled to the modern capital of Ljubliana. This year, the Michelin Guide handed out stars to seven restaurants in Slovenia.


Norway

Norway is consistently included on lists of the world’s happiest countries. So what’s their secret? Mette-Marit has one answer: “We love being outside in nature. If you’re in a Norwegian home on a Sunday and you don’t go for a walk in the forest.... that’s not good.”
